1 definition by Antimatterjr

The collective noun for a gathering of Karens
I saw a vexation of Karens leaving church and heading to the Cracker Barrel to torment the servers and leave no tip before requesting to speak to the manager....
by Antimatterjr April 20, 2021
Get the Vexation mug.